Heavenly Father,

We come before You today with humble hearts, seeking Your divine presence and guidance in our lives. We lift up our voices in prayer, asking for peace in the world, in our communities, and within ourselves. We remember John Williams, a beacon of hope and a symbol of the beauty that music can bring to our lives. As we reflect on his contributions, we are reminded of the power of art to heal, inspire, and unite us in our shared humanity.

Lord, we ask that You grant us the serenity that surpasses all understanding. In a world filled with chaos, conflict, and uncertainty, we seek Your calming spirit to wash over us. May Your peace envelop those who are troubled, those who are suffering, and those who are in despair. Help us to be instruments of Your peace, spreading love and compassion wherever we go.

We pray for the leaders of our nations, that they may be guided by wisdom and integrity. May they seek not their own interests, but the welfare of all people. Inspire them to work towards reconciliation and understanding, to bridge divides and foster unity. Let their hearts be open to dialogue and their minds receptive to the voices of those they serve.

Lord, we also pray for those who are affected by violence, war, and injustice. Comfort the broken-hearted and bring healing to the wounded. Surround them with Your love and grace, and may they find solace in the knowledge that they are not alone. We ask that You provide them with strength and courage to endure their trials, and that they may one day experience the joy of peace restored.

As we reflect on the music of John Williams, we are reminded of the beauty that can emerge from adversity. May his melodies inspire us to create harmony in our own lives and in the lives of others. Help us to find ways to express our love for one another through our words and actions. Let us remember that we are all part of a larger symphony, each note contributing to the beauty of the whole.

We pray for our communities, that they may be places of refuge and support. Help us to foster relationships built on trust and respect, where differences are celebrated and common ground is sought. May we work together to build a future where peace reigns, and where every individual is valued and heard.

Lord, we also turn inward, seeking peace within our own hearts. Help us to release any anger, resentment, or fear that may reside within us. Grant us the courage to forgive those who have wronged us and to seek forgiveness from those we have hurt. May we find the strength to let go of the burdens we carry and to embrace the freedom that comes with Your peace.

As we close this prayer, we ask for Your continued guidance and support. May we be reminded that peace is not merely the absence of conflict, but the presence of justice, love, and understanding. Let us strive to embody these values in our daily lives, and may our actions reflect the light of Your peace.

In Your holy name, we pray.

Amen.
